Hi, all. I'm a newbie to POTC. So far, I love the ocean graphics, but it kind of spoils it to have that big, dark crosshair in the center of the screen.

In an attempt to rectify this, I mucked around with the textures and came up with a version that reduces contrast in the alpha in order to give the crosshairs a bit of transparency. See below for the before and after pictures:

This works pretty well, I think. I have a couple of questions, though:

* I saved the texture in DXT3 format. Is that okay? I notice that he file size is a fair bit smaller than the original. It works for me, but I wonder if other video cards will have a problem.

* I originally tried adjusting the crosshairs through the code in the AIcameras. file. It includes values for argb for different states (default, enemy, friendly, etc.), but the "a" (I assume this is alpha) didn't really do anything, and I was having a hard time sorting out what effect changing the colors had (it didn't seem as straightforward as I would have thought). Is it possible to achieve a transparency simply through editing that code? If so, I'd prefer to do it that way and have the crosshairs almost completely transparent when it isn't on a target.

Hi Mackenson...

I think the "argb" will just change colors. What you've done is probably the best way to deal with it - and as far as saving, well, I usually use DXT5, although I don't think there would be a problem saving it as DXT3. The smaller file size might also have to do with the fact that you lowered the number of colors in the save...
